Defining VLAN Ports Settings

The VLAN Port Settings page provides parameters for managing ports that are part of a
VLAN.
The Port Default VLAN ID (PVID) is configured on the VLAN Port Settings page. All
untagged packets arriving to the device are tagged by the ports PVID. To open the VLAN
Port Settings page:
Click Switch > VLAN > Port Settings in the Tree View. The VLAN Port Settings
page opens.
